Boltonia caroliniana, common name Carolina doll's-daisy, is a North American species of plants in the family Asteraceae.
It is found only in the southeastern United States, primarily in the states of North Carolina, South Carolina, and Virginia with a few isolated populations in western Georgia.
[2] Boltonia caroliniana is a perennial herb up to 200 cm (80 inches) tall.
It has many daisy-like flower heads with white or lilac ray florets and yellow disc florets.
[3][4][5] The Carolina doll's-daisy can grow to 4–6 feet tall, with a waxy smooth stem and leaves.
